<br />e <br /> <br />e <br /> <br />6.2.2.4 If the Bidding or Negotiating Phase has not comnenced <br />within six months after completion of the Final Design Phase, the <br />established Construction Cost limit will not be binding on <br />ARCHITECT, and OWNER shall consent to an adjustment in such cost <br />limit commensurate with any applicable change in the general level <br />of prices in the construction industry between the date of <br />completion of the Final Design Phase and the date on which <br />proposals or bids are sought. <br /> <br />6.2.2.5 If the lowest bona fide proposal or bid exceeds the <br />established Construction Cost limit, OWNER shall (1) give written <br />approval to increase such cost limit, (2) authorize negotiating or <br />rebidding the Project within sixty (60) days, or (3) cooperate in <br />revising the proj ect 's general scope, extent or character to the <br />extent consistent with the Project's requirements and with sound <br />engineering/architectural practices. In the case of (3), ARCHITECT <br />shall modify the Contract Documents as necessary to bring the <br />Construction Cost within the cost limit. No compensation will be <br />made for services in making such modifications per paragraph <br />5.1.1.2. The providing of such service will be the limit of <br />ARCHITECT's responsibility in this regard and, having done so, <br />ARCHITECT shall be entitled to payment for services in accordance <br />with this Agreement and will not otherwise be liable for damages <br />attributable to the lowest bona fide proposal or bid exceeding the <br />established Construction Cost. <br /> <br />6-2 <br />
